Rome (Italy), Feb 25 (ANI): Thousands joined a march against racism in Rome amidst debate over immigration during the pre-poll phase. The march was joined by prominent leaders like Prime Minister Paolo Gentiloni, other politicians and unionists as well to call for a stop to racism and fascism in the country. In a sign of increasing tensions ahead of the March 4 national election, earlier this month, the far-left protestors and members of a neo-fascist party engaged in a scuffle across Italy.
